The City of Duluth has announced that they are closing a pedestrian bridge because of structural integrity concerns.

The wooden pedestrian bridge that connects to the area known as "The Deeps" in Lester Park is being closed.

The city said that the bridge across Amity Creek is being barricaded due to "cracks in the support beam, rotting, and missing rocks from the abutment. The bridge will need to be replaced next summer pending administrative review from the Minnesota Department of Natural Resources."
